Leisure, gaming and gambling

Whitbread taking right action in tough market, says Credit Suisse

The broker says the firm is taking the right actions in a tough market but chops back the target

Credit Suisse is one of several brokers to dip into Whitbread plc (LON:WTB) on Wednesday following interim results yesterday and has chopped down the price target to 4,030p from 4,360p.

It says the firm is taking the right actions in a tough market, namely chasing down efficiencies, investing where needed, and focusing on scale opportunities internationally.

Credit rates shares 'neutral' due to a lengthy list of what it calls "uncertainties", including Airbnb, five years of 6-7% National Living Wage increases, the UK macro landscape post Brexit and Costa's cost investment/margin falls.

It also cuts its estimates for 2018 EPS (earnings per share) by 5% driven by an effective profit warning for Costa.

Yesterday's half year results from the Costa Coffee and premier Inn owner did beat market expectations slightly and the group as a whole posted LFL (like-for-like) sales of 2% - up from 1.8% in the first quarter.

But this is increasingly being driven by room extensions rather than RevPAR (revenues per available room) or like-for-like sales at Costa - hence is likely to be a drag on returns.

Societe Generale today cut the price target on the shares to 4,100p from 4,220.30 and rates the stock a 'hold'.

Scribes at Barclays Capital also covered the stock today and repeated an 'underweight' stance and a 3340p price target.
